Children are always welcome in worship! As Pastor Sean often says, children should be both seen and heard - and we promise they won't bother him. We love both the sight and sound of children in worship, and we encourage all ages of kids to experience what it means to be a part of worship in the Body of Christ. If needed, or desired, there are Children's Worship Activity Bags available at the doors to the sanctuary, just ask an usher!


We also recognize that children need age-appropriate instruction, and that for some parents, Sunday School and/or the nursery is preferable option. Parents are encouraged to make the decision that is best for your family, and we promise that our congregation will support you in whichever option you choose!


Holy Communion is an integral part of our worship services, and as United Methodists, we believe in what is called an open table. Your ability to partake in the sacrament is not based on your membership at Buckhall or any other church, and all are welcome to receive.

Our regular worship service features a style of worship that is unique to Buckhall Church. In this worship service, you will find biblical, passionate preaching from our pastor, as well as a wide variety of musical elements. We utilize traditional hymns, to new contemporary music, to pieces written by our musical leadership, and everything in between - all in an effort to worship God passionately.

Communion is held once a month on the first Sunday of the month at our traditional services; though occasionally it may be offered more frequently.  

Frequently Asked Questions

How should I dress?

You can, and honestly, should dress however you are comfortable.  Because people come to Buckhall from all different walks of life, you will see all styles of dress. Whether you're in your Sunday best, or your shorts and t-shirt, we're excited to see you on Sunday morning.

How do I get there?

Buckhall is located at 10251 Moore Drive; Manassas, VA 20111 at the intersection of the Prince William Parkway and Moore Drive.  Access to our parking lot is from Moore Drive.

Where do I park?

There is parking in the front of the building. The parking lot is accessed from Moore Drive. There is visitor parking in front of the church entrance, but please feel free to park wherever you are comfortable.

What happens when I walk in the doors?

When you walk in the doors of our church, you will be welcomed by our greeting team.  If this is your first visit to Buckhall, please let someone direct you to the nursery/Sunday School rooms, hospitality center, sanctuary, and restrooms.

What about access?

The main buildings of the church are on one level, with no steps. 

Handicapped and visitor parking are located next to the main entrance.
